THOMASTON – State Rep. John Piscopo (R-78) recently attended the Thomaston Volunteer Fire Department’s annual banquet, along with veteran and active duty members of the fire department, the woman’s auxiliary, and explorers, local dignitaries, and guests.
Among the awards given that evening, Rep. Piscopo was honored by the Thomaston Volunteer Fire Department for his dedication and commitment to the department and to fire services across the state. Rep. Piscopo was presented with a plaque by Chief James O’Neill, who informed guests that the award was being given as a surprise to the legislator.
“What an incredible surprise. I am deeply honored and humbled to receive this recognition. I was proud to attend the Thomaston Volunteer Fire Department’s banquet this year, in support of those who bravely and selflessly give their time to protect our citizens. This recognition will be one of the most memorable and cherished of my life because it comes from people whom I deeply respect and admire,” said Rep. Piscopo.
